Today's actor/subject/model is the gorgeous and talented Halee-Catherine Culicerto, photographed by Arthur Cohen (whom you can contact via www.arthurcohen.com).
She just finished a staged reading of Angels Without Wings at The Z. Alexander Looby Theatre and will be directing it again come August at the Darkhorse Theater.
Today, April 15, is her birthday, so if you run into her be sure to extend your good wishes to you; it shouldn't be too awfully taxing.
Among Halee's recent credits are:
- Emma in Jekyll and Hyde
- Lucy in Dracula
- Lola in Damn Yankees
- Midas Bradford in One Kiss Cafe
